Great product, great customer service

I purchased a pair of Ohai sunglasses 13 months ago. A screw had come loose and lost. I contacted Maui Jim and asked them to send a screw in the post. Unfortunately, they didn't send it along but asked instead that I send my sunglasses to them (this is the only reason why it's 4, and not 5, stars).

As I live just under an hour away from the repair centre, I asked if I could drive over for the repair. They confirmed the address and I popped over.

Whilst there, they immediately checked the sunglasses over and took it in for repair. A chap named Tony helped me out - and he was pleasant, helpful, and paid attention to detail.

When he inspected the sunglasses, he noticed that not only my screw was missing, but the nose bridge pieces too! He went away and fixed them and, when he came back, he informed me that he found that the frame was ever so slightly bent, and so was the nose bridge (I didn't realise I was mistreating them!). He replaced them all, free of charge (under warranty still) in rapid time.

Uber impressed. This was a great test of my loyalty to the brand: they're my first pair of sunglasses with them, but they won't be the last. More than happy with the product too - I've moved away from RayBan and much prefer the quality and customer serivce.

Stick to Rayban or Oakley for quality

Firstly, Maui Jim UK customer services is superb without question. However; the lenses on the sunglasses aren’t that great. I own lots of pairs of Rayban and Oakley sunglasses and have never had any issues. I bought one pair of Maui Jim sunglasses for my wife, the Kawika blue lense. Within a couple of weeks the lenses had lots of tiny scratches all over them but she had only wore them on two occasions which was strange. We took them to UK customer service as it was fairly local to us and they checked our receipt and changed the lenses without question - fantastic. The only thing we could put it down to was dusty grit in the cleaner cloth maybe, otherwise no clue why they scratched soo easy. I checked my Rayban glasses which I’ve used on hols for years and no scratches anywhere. Seems strange to me but now these Maui’s are sat in drawer never used, she just uses Rayban, far cheaper and you can’t fault the quality of frames and lenses.
It’s a shame because I want to give 5 stars here but that would be because of Customer Services and not the quality of the glasses but my wife is gutted about the quality. It’s also worth mentioning the Maui’s have never been out of the UK, so we’re not used on a beach holiday where sand could get the lense, so again, only used a couple of times in the UK whilst driving the car and walking about. Not great and unfortunately I wouldn’t recommend Maui’s or buy them again when compared to Ray’s or Oakley.

Maui Jim HT lenses transformed my hiking trip of a lifetime

I decided to get a new Maui Jim style and lens for a hiking trip to Patagonia and it turned out way better than expected.

Over the last 30+ years I’ve gone from grey to rose to bronze lenses and from regular to bifocals (an aging thing). A couple months ago I learned I needed a prescription lens and stuck with Maui Jim because the product and service have proven to be worth the cost.

My strategy was to use the Rx sunglasses for golf and a planned hiking trip to Patagonia. The new HT tint was recommended. It would keep things sharp in cloudy or rainy weather as well as in sun.

When they arrived I was happy with the new sharpness of my vision, but going to Patagonia took that feeling to a new level. Transformed the experience.

We hiked for 7-12 hours daily in all kinds of weather. The glasses handled rain, snow, bright sun, super heavy wind and my sweat from all the steep ups and downs flawlessly. They were comfortable, anchored to my head, protected my eyes from the elements, gave me awesome clarity and depth perception, and thinking back, I didn’t consciously know that I had them on.

Great lens, sturdy frame, great prescription technology. Unexpectedly a highlight of the awesome trip! Thanks!
